| description | A preimage attack on DHA-256 hash function reduced to 37-round and a pseudo collision attack on the func-tion reduced to 39-round were proposed respectively.Based on the meet-in-the-middle attack,the Biclique technique was used to improve the preimage attack from 35-round to 37-round.A 39-round pseudo collision was achieved using the Bi-clique technique.Overall,a preimage of DHA-256 was constructed with a complexity of 2<sup>255.5</sup>and a memory of 2<sup>3</sup>.Besides,a pseudo collision of DHA-256 was proposed with a complexity of 2<sup>127.5</sup>.These are the best results of preimage and collision attack on DHA-256 hash function. |
